BAS86 Vishay Semiconductors New Product formerly General Semiconductor Schottky Diode MiniMELF (SOD-80C) Cathode Band .063 (1.6) Dia. .051 (1.3) .146 (3.7) .130 (3.3) .019 (0.48) .011 (0.28) Features * For general purpose applications * This diode features low turn-on voltage. The devices are protected by a PN junction guard ring against excessive voltage, such as electrostatic discharges. * Metal-on-silicon Schottky barrier device which is protected by a PN junction guard ring. * The low forward voltage drop and fast switching make it ideal for protection of MOS devices, steering, biasing and coupling diodes for fast switching and low logic level applications * This diode is also available in a DO-35 case with type designation BAT86.
